Why Lithium Battery Recycling Isn't Just Smart - It's Essential
We're living in an electric revolution - EVs zipping down highways, power banks charging our lives, and renewable energy storage transforming how we power our world. But behind this clean energy utopia lies a ticking time bomb of spent lithium batteries. Here's what makes them so tricky:
- ⚡ Volatile chemical cocktails just waiting for the wrong conditions
- Thermal runaway threats that can turn recycling into a firefighter's nightmare
- ⏳ Slow processing methods that create safety bottlenecks
- Critical resources trapped inside that our planet desperately needs back
That's where specialized shredders come in - the unsung heroes making circular economies possible while preventing recycling centers from turning into disaster zones.

Specifications That Matter: Technical Deep Dive
Let's geek out on what makes these machines tick. Below are the key operational parameters across popular models - think of this as the DNA profile of battery recycling superheroes:
MSB-E600: The Middleweight Champion
- Processing Throat: 600mm strategic entry point
- Engine Power: Twin 22kW electric hearts
- Blade System: 16 German alloy teeth in staggered formation
- Safety Response: 4 simultaneous fire control systems
- Footprint: Compact 2.5m × 1.3m operational stance
MSC-E1900: Industrial Heavy Hitter
- Processing Throat: Massive 1,870mm × 2,070mm
- Engine Power: Quad 74kW powerplants
- Throughput: 4 tons/hour sustainable rhythm
- Automation Level: Fully autonomous monitoring
- Footprint: 10m × 10.5m strategic deployment
